爆火的Deepseek初体验:技术解析与实战指南
2025.09.26 20:07浏览量:0简介:本文深度解析爆火的Deepseek技术架构,结合开发者与企业视角,通过实战案例展示其核心能力与优化策略,为技术选型与业务落地提供可复用的方法论。
一、Deepseek爆火的技术基因解码
Deepseek的爆发式增长并非偶然,其技术底座由三大核心模块构成:
- 分布式计算引擎
采用改进型MapReduce架构,通过动态任务分片与负载均衡算法,在10万级节点集群中实现99.9%的任务调度成功率。实测数据显示,处理10TB日志数据的耗时较传统方案缩短62%,其关键优化点在于:
- 智能分片策略:基于数据特征分布的动态分块算法
- 故障容错机制:三级检查点与快速恢复协议
# 动态分片示例代码def dynamic_sharding(data_size, cluster_nodes):base_size = data_size // cluster_nodesremainder = data_size % cluster_nodesshards = [base_size] * cluster_nodesfor i in range(remainder):shards[i] += 1return shards
- 自适应模型架构
融合Transformer-XL与稀疏注意力机制,在保持模型精度的同时降低37%的计算开销。其创新点体现在:
- 动态深度调整:根据输入复杂度自动切换4/8/16层编码器
- 混合精度训练:FP16与BF16的动态切换策略
- 双流合并机制:状态流与事件流的协同处理
- 增量检查点:每5秒生成差异更新包
二、开发者实战指南:从入门到精通
1. 环境搭建三步法
- 容器化部署:使用Docker Compose快速启动开发环境
version: '3.8'services:deepseek-core:image: deepseek/engine:latestports:- "8080:8080"volumes:- ./config:/etc/deepseekenvironment:- DS_MODE=development
配置优化:针对不同场景调整JVM参数
- 批处理模式:
-Xms16g -Xmx32g -XX:+UseG1GC - 流处理模式:
-Xms4g -Xmx8g -XX:+UseZGC
- 批处理模式:
性能调优:通过JMX监控关键指标
- 任务积压量(Backlog)
- 处理延迟(P99)
- 资源利用率(CPU/Memory)
2. 核心API使用范式
数据接入层:
// 使用SDK接入实时数据流DeepseekClient client = new DeepseekClient.Builder().endpoint("ds-api.example.com").apiKey("YOUR_API_KEY").build();DataStream stream = client.createStream().topic("financial_transactions").partition(3).consumerGroup("risk_control");
模型推理层:
from deepseek import ModelServerserver = ModelServer(model_path="ds_model_v2.1",batch_size=128,precision="fp16")results = server.predict([{"text": "市场波动分析...", "context": "risk_assessment"},# 更多输入样本...])
三、企业级应用场景深度剖析
1. 金融风控解决方案
在某银行反欺诈系统中,Deepseek实现:
- 实时决策:<50ms的响应延迟
- 特征工程:自动生成200+风险指标
- 模型迭代:每周自动更新风险规则库
关键技术实现:
-- 实时特征计算示例CREATE MATERIALIZED VIEW risk_features ASSELECTuser_id,COUNT(DISTINCT device_id) OVER (PARTITION BY user_id ORDER BY event_time ROWS BETWEEN 10 PRECEDING AND CURRENT ROW) AS device_switch_count,AVG(transaction_amount) OVER (PARTITION BY user_id ORDER BY event_time ROWS BETWEEN 24 PRECEDING AND CURRENT ROW) AS avg_24h_amountFROM transactions
2. 智能制造优化实践
某汽车工厂通过Deepseek实现:
- 设备预测维护:故障预测准确率提升40%
- 产线平衡优化:OEE指标提高18%
- 质量追溯系统:缺陷定位时间缩短至分钟级
实施路径:
- 数据采集层:部署500+个工业传感器
- 特征工程层:构建时序特征库(含300+特征)
- 模型训练层:采用增量学习策略
- 应用部署层:边缘计算节点实时推理
四、避坑指南与优化策略
1. 常见问题解决方案
- 内存泄漏:检查G1GC回收日志,调整
-XX:InitiatingHeapOccupancyPercent参数 - 网络延迟:启用TCP_NODELAY,调整
net.core.rmem_max - 模型过拟合:增加L2正则化项,使用Dropout层
2. 性能优化黄金法则
- 批处理优化:保持batch_size在64-256之间
- 并行度调整:根据CPU核心数设置
spark.default.parallelism - 缓存策略:对频繁访问的数据启用Alluxio缓存
3. 成本优化方案
- 资源调度:采用Kubernetes的Horizontal Pod Autoscaler
- 存储优化:使用Zstandard压缩算法减少存储开销
- 计算优化:对冷数据采用Spot实例处理
五、未来演进方向展望
- 多模态融合:集成文本、图像、音频的跨模态理解能力
- 联邦学习支持:实现跨机构数据的安全协作
- AutoML增强:自动化模型选择与超参优化
- 边缘计算深化:开发轻量化推理引擎
结语:Deepseek的爆火源于其技术深度与场景适配性的完美平衡。对于开发者而言,掌握其核心原理与最佳实践,将能在AI工程化浪潮中占据先机;对于企业用户,合理规划技术路线与实施路径,方能实现真正的业务价值转化。建议从POC验证开始,逐步扩展至全业务链覆盖,同时保持对社区动态的持续关注。

发表评论
登录后可评论,请前往 登录 或 注册